Extra virgin olive oil stands as the prime example of this category, offering a robust flavor profile and a dense amount of antioxidants. These fats are known for their ability to support heart health by helping to maintain healthy blood pressure and reducing low-density lipoprotein (LDL) cholesterol without lowering the beneficial high-density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ol.
